How to Actually Get Started with Python
Summary
This guide offers a streamlined path for individuals seeking to learn Python, emphasizing practical application over exhaustive theoretical knowledge. It focuses on delivering only the essential components required to achieve tangible progress and build functional projects. The content highlights Python's versatility across various professional domains, including data analytics, machine learning, web development, scripting, automation, and large language model (LLM) applications, positioning it as a crucial skill for diverse career paths. The guide aims to cut through common learning obstacles like information overload, providing a direct route to proficiency.
Key takeaway
For aspiring developers or data professionals looking to acquire Python skills efficiently, your focus should be on practical application rather than comprehensive theoretical mastery. Prioritize learning the core functionalities that enable you to build and deploy projects quickly, as this approach directly translates to career versatility in fields like ML, web, and automation. Avoid getting bogged down by excessive resources; instead, seek out curated learning paths.
Key insights
Focus on practical, shippable Python skills to accelerate learning and career versatility.
Principles
- Prioritize essential knowledge.
- Versatility enhances career options.
Method
The guide advocates for a focused learning approach, selecting only the Python components that directly contribute to building functional applications and achieving tangible progress.
In practice
- Apply Python to analytics.
- Develop LLM applications.
Topics
- Python Programming
- Machine Learning
- Web Development
- Automation
- LLM Applications
Best for: AI Student, Software Engineer, Data Scientist
Related on AIssential
Editorial summary, takeaway, and curation by AIssential. Original article published by DataBites.